The Supervisor, Airport Operations Control, is responsible for supervising the PSS and DCC teams, guiding them in all aspects of their work. They support all Air Transat operations involving the various airport stakeholders in passenger services, departure control and various communications. The Supervisor is also the point of contact between the operational teams and the IOC Duty Manager.

**Job Summary**

Reporting to the Director, Airport Operations Control, the IOC Supervisor, Airport Operations Control, is part of a team of several supervisors, who support the PSS and DCC teams from the IOC, in managing day-to-day operations, and provide the necessary follow-up in special situations. He plays a key role in managing irregular operations, supporting his teams and ensuring communication with the Duty Manager and the various departments involved. He ensures that service levels are respected and that all Air Transat procedures are followed.

He also participates in various meetings and operational committees, and follows up on services that have not met established requirements. He provides an analysis of the causes and recommendations for corrective measures, and prepares all documentation relating to ongoing follow-ups.

The supervisor handles files requiring special assistance, and ensures good communication with all departments involved in operations. He also handles performance reviews and disciplinary follow-ups when required, as well as certain administrative tasks such as scheduling. He plays an active role in establishing procedures and providing training for his agents.
